Birth Injury

It is a stressful process and can cause different injuries for the mother and the baby. Erb's palsy, caused by a doctor's use excessive force or traction during the delivery, is an extremely common birth injury that can happen as a result of medical negligence.

The condition is caused by damage to the brachial nerves that control movement of the shoulder, arm and hand. Erb's syndrome can cause physical limitations that are severe, such as discomfort, numbness and difficulties moving the affected arm. In some cases the injured arm may never be fully healed.

Erb's palsy results from the destruction of a bundle nerves known as the brachial plexus that runs from the infant's spinal cord to their hands and arms. The condition typically occurs in cases of shoulder dystocia, or complications during childbirth.
